be nice wicka posted:idk but alonso and button seemed genuinely pleased Key is the speed trap figures. McLaren were posting speed trap figures only a couple of kph off Hamilton's which given even in the last test week they were still 15+ kph off shows they have not just made massive improvement, but they could seriously be fighting for the top of F1 Category 2 (everyone but Merc). Still at least 1 second off joining Category 1 though, but then again so is every other team - especially given how strong Hamilton was in the practice sessions; this season does have already signs of being even more 1 sided than the previous 2. All unknown though until qualifying tomorrow, and many times Aussie practice sessions have been little help in showing how the qualifying actually plays out.
